I have read "Kill everyone" by Lee Nelson and co. and have founf it to be pretty good. There is some very complex maths that they go through which is a bit of a headf#ck at times, and im pretty good at maths - so the average person will find this way over their head i think. But the rest is very good. easy to read etc
Just download caro the other night too and started reading that (i know im probably way behind the times) but its obviously very good. The main part i think i have been missing is all the information i can gain form opponents just from when they sit at the table, not even playing a hand.
Things like their dress, how they stack their chips, their posture at the table (even after they have folded their hand) etc can give valuable information that i will definately use, perhaps not for regular NPL, but definately for the larger games (SF & AM etc) of at the cas if i ever play there again.
Im thinking of building my poker library. i have read most of super system too, but i have found lee nelsons book more beneficial to me. However most apects of theories outlined in these books are hard to apply to NPL's super turbo format. Thats why im starting to read about tells etc, cos they will apply any time i sit at the poker table.
